Understanding the Mechanics of the Digital Plinko Board
At its heart, the plinko game relies on a predictable unpredictability. The path a puck takes down the board is determined by a series of random deflections as it encounters the strategically placed pegs. Each peg represents a potential turning point, sending the puck either left or right. While the initial drop point can sometimes be user-controlled, the cascading effect of these bounces ultimately governs the final outcome, making each game a unique and suspenseful event. The placement of these pegs, and their density, heavily influences the probabilities associated with different payout slots at the base of the board. A densely packed area generally results in a more consistent and less lucrative outcome, while wider spaces afford greater potential for reaching higher-value sections.

The Role of Random Number Generators in Fairness
A robust random number generator is the cornerstone of any trustworthy online plinko game. These algorithms produce a sequence of numbers that appear completely random, dictating the puck's trajectory at each peg encounter. A truly random sequence is crucial to prevent any predictable patterns or biases that could be exploited by individuals attempting to manipulate the game. Reputable platforms utilize certified RNGs, meaning they have been independently tested and verified by third-party auditing firms to ensure their integrity. These certifications serve as a mark of trustworthiness, assuring players that the game is conducted fairly and without any hidden advantages for the house.
The complexity of these RNGs can vary significantly. Simpler versions might rely on linear congruential generators, while more sophisticated algorithms incorporate cryptographic hash functions and other advanced techniques to improve randomness and security. Regardless of the underlying methodology, the key is to ensure that each outcome is statistically independent, meaning that previous results have no influence on future ones. Transparency regarding the RNG’s operation is also vital; many platforms openly disclose the details of their algorithms and auditing processes to build confidence among their user base.

Provably Fair Systems and Blockchain Integration
The concept of "provably fair" is central to the appeal of blockchain-based plinko games. It refers to a system that allows players to independently verify the fairness of each game outcome. This is achieved through cryptographic techniques that utilize seed values and hashing algorithms. Players can access the seed value used to generate the game result and verify that it was not tampered with by the platform. This transparency is a significant departure from traditional online games, where the fairness of the RNG is often opaque.
Blockchain integration further enhances the security and trustworthiness of these systems. Game results can be recorded on an immutable blockchain ledger, providing a permanent and auditable record of every outcome. This prevents the platform from retroactively altering results or manipulating the gameplay. The use of smart contracts automates the payout process, ensuring that winners receive their rewards promptly and securely.
